Hi, I am trying to install MKL on Ububtu 18.04 via apt-get but am presented with a dependency error:
l_onemkl_p_2022.2.1.16993_offline$ sudo sh ./install.sh
/MKL/l_onemkl_p_2022.2.1.16993_offline/bootstrapper: error while loading shared libraries: libQt6Core5Compat.so.6: cannot open shared object file: No such file or directory
How can I proceed here? The installation notes state 18.04 LTS is supported. Is there a non-GUI install I can try to bypass the need for speciic Qt libraries?
Thanks.

Worked around this by using the online installer and launching as sudo from the root usr folder. Original issue not helped by using an Ububtu VM with host-mapped drives leading to permissions problems that sometimes manifest as other issues.
